Output e6037fdb8eace6733230889256c64effc089bc6d754a85503ffb2f53f320c75a:0

value
29730000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a9c6e158a8745059f07940ebde642042c785c88 OP_EQUAL
address
3QY8FT28gRcL7zE7AGQJD8oUwuo6HC1Qxf
transaction
e6037fdb8eace6733230889256c64effc089bc6d754a85503ffb2f53f320c75a
spent
true